Calling all junior crime fighters! Join us for a live, interactive storytelling event where you’ll help author Andrew McDonald and illustrator Ben Wood, creators of the hilarious Real Pigeons series, solve a real live mystery! 

To celebrate the launch of Real Pigeons Spy High, Andrew and Ben will bring a pigeon puzzle to life right before your eyes with live drawings, sound effects and all your favourite feathery heroes (and villains). In order to solve this mystery the Real Pigeons are going to need YOUR HELP!
